Protein Domain : Knr4/Smi1 family IPR009203

Type  Family
Description  This entry includes a group of fungal proteins that are involved in cell wall biosynthesis, including Smi1 from S. cerevisiae and Cot2 from Neurospora crassa. Smi1 (also known as Knr4) is involved in the regulation of cell wall assembly and 1,3-beta-glucan synthesis, possibly through the transcriptional regulation of cell wall glucan and chitin synthesis [ , ]. Cot2 is required for (1,3) beta-glucan synthase activity and cell wall formation [].
